How Negligence Is Established

To present a personal injury claim, it is generally necessary to show that another party had a duty of care, breached that duty, and caused the injuries and losses suffered. Experienced Costa Mesa Personal Injury Lawyers carefully evaluate every aspect of a case to determine how negligence occurred and what evidence may support the claim.

Evidence may include medical records, photographs, camera recordings, police reports, witness statements, professional analysis, and other relevant documentation. The stronger the evidence, the better positioned an injured victim may be when negotiating an insurance claim.

Why Prompt Investigation Matters

Evidence can become unavailable quickly following an accident. Surveillance recordings may be overwritten, accident scenes may change, vehicles may be repaired, and witnesses may become difficult to locate. Conducting a prompt investigation allows important evidence to be identified before it is lost.

Protecting Your Rights After an Injury

  1. Seek immediate medical evaluation.
  2. Report the accident when appropriate.
  3. Gather visual evidence whenever possible.
  4. Identify anyone who observed the incident.
  5. Keep organized records of your recovery.
  6. Be cautious when speaking with insurance adjusters.
DocumentationPurpose
Medical RecordsDemonstrates injuries and recovery
Scene ImagesShows accident conditions
Eyewitness AccountsProvides independent observations
Property Damage RecordsSupports compensation claims
Employment RecordsSupports lost earnings claims

How Insurance Companies Evaluate Personal Injury Claims

Following a serious accident, claims administrators typically begin evaluating the circumstances surrounding the incident. Their investigation may include reviewing treatment documentation, interviewing witnesses, examining photographs, inspecting property damage, and analyzing official reports. While insurers have an obligation to investigate claims, their primary objective is often to limit financial exposure. What if I was partially responsible for the accident?

California law may allow injured individuals to pursue compensation even when responsibility is shared, although the specific facts of each case are important.
